Help when I need it most...
I recently had surgery on my foot and have needed to be on crutches and out of work. My husband works evenings, and so I was not looking forward to the logistics of caring for our three toddlers for the evenings of the first week or two after surgery. The day before the operation, my colleagues at the Diocese of Saint Cloud gathered in my office and sang a blessing to me, presented me with tender gifts, and offered to help in any ways needed. They knew that I was nervous about lining up help because we're pretty new to the community and have no local family here. For the two weeks after surgery, each night, either a colleague or friends from CM TEC took a shift in coming to my house at dinnertime and helping feed/bathe/read to my kids before helping tuck everyone in. Some brought meals, others insisted on taking the cleanup duties. And each day, at least one of our employees sent me an email letting me know that I was in being prayed for. Talk about kind people! I sincerely look forward to going back to work with them.
